By Dr Mandy M Barnett, psychology graduate, clinical educator and retired consultant physician

Dr Mandy M Barnett worked for over 30 years in the NHS, and as an Associate Clinical Professor at Warwick Medical School (WMS). She is also a Fellow of the Royal College of Physicians.

When Covid hit in March 2020, she became aware of a huge spike of cases of Tourette’s syndrome being reported in the press.

As the mother of two children (Alex and Angelica James) who both have Tourette’s syndrome, and with her background in medicine and education, she realised that this was something that she had a unique perspective on, and decided to write a guidebook for parents, which she completed in May 2022.

The book is titled: It’s NOT All About Swearing! A Practical Guide to Tourette’s Syndrome for Parents in a Post-Pandemic World

It is now available on Amazon in paperback and kindle versions.

 

10% of all author royalties will be donated to Tourette’s Action
